Juliet Capulet

The main heroine of the tragedy is Juliet Capulet, a fourteen-year-old carefree girl. However, despite her young age, she has a non-child depth of thinking. She is rich, both internal and external beauty, constantly attracts and fascinates with her blooming youth. The heroine is represented in the image of a clean, educated and intelligent lady who is constantly surrounded by the love of caring noble parents, a cousin to whom she is strongly attached and a girlfriend whom she trusts all her girlish secrets. Juliet lives in full prosperity but does not think about marriage, but at heart, she dreams to meet her prince. She always obeys the will of her parents and never dares to contradict them.
